Title: Help setting ignition timing on a Yamaha AT1 with a vape system.
Post by: e30 gangsta on January 03, 2024, 06:10:26 PM
Hello friends,

I am looking for the timing specification for a 1971 Yamaha At1.

I'm installed a new vape system and set the piston to 1.8 btdc.

I installed the base plate and made sure that the bolts were in the middle of the slots, then I installed the flywheel and matched the timing mark on it with the base plate timing mark.

Now my question is once everything is installed and aligned, how do you verify that the timing is not too advanced or retarded seeing as there is no external timing marks/pointer to reference with a timing light, besides the one on the flywheel and the base plate? Thoughts?

Set piston at 1.8 and take a marking pen and make a mark anywhere on the rotor and then another mark on the backing plate that line up with each other. When the marks line up piston is at 1.8. Start and check if they line up using a timing light. If not, and you have to adjust the backing plate, you will have to redo the marks because you will be moving the backing plate and the original marks won't be at 1.8 anymore when they lined up.
